This year's "Downtown Sound" Series at Millennium Park comes to a riotous conclusion tonight with Midwestern hip-hop goddesses Dessa from Minneapolis and local sensation Psalm One. Psalm One opens. The show at Pritzker Pavilion starts at 6:30 p.m.

The weather has been neither wet nor hot lately, but you can still get your fix of late summer fun at Hideout tonight with a screening of David Wain's 2001 cult classic Wet Hot American Summer at 8 p.m. The screening is a fundraiser for Chicago Zine Fest 2014. The first 20 people through the door will receive a 2013 Chicago Zine Fest t-shirt (designed by local artist Laura Berger). (1354 W. Wabansia, doors open at 7 p.m.)
